📖 About This Game
In Widgets n' Digit$ you play the role of a business owner. Your goal is to scale your widget manufacturing process and earn the most money by the end of the fiscal year.
Each turn you'll produce widgets in 4 steps.
First you create a raw material, which becomes a part, then a finished good, and finally a widget which sells for $20.
In order to increase the amount of widgets you produce you need to upgrade each of the 4 steps by buying upgrade cards, but due to limited resources you can usually only afford 1-2 cards per turn. This means that upgrading will leave you with bottlenecks in your widget supply chain.
You can still profit with bottlenecks by buying the resources you need or selling excess resources in the market. But each transaction shifts the price of goods.
You'll need to adapt your strategy to market economics and carefully consider the risk of each investment in order to win in this economic strategy game!
There are 2 included expansions:
Worker Wars - Introduces a competitive labor market for the workers who run your widget making process. You'll need to bid against your competitors for the right to hire workers - the wrong price can have devastating impact to your bottom line!
Boardroom Battle - Introduces 12 unique card abilities to the game. You must balance profitability with powerful game controlling abilities.
